WATER ACT 1989 - SECT 36

Application for bulk entitlement

    (1)     An Authority may apply to the Minister for the grant of a bulk entitlement to—

        (a)     water in a waterway (including the River Murray); or

        (b)     groundwater; or

S. 36(1)(c) amended by Nos 50/1992 s. 10(Sch. item 11.3), 121/1994 s. 188(c), 62/1995 s. 10(a), 99/2005 s. 15(a).

        (c)     water, other than recycled water, in any works of another Authority; or

S. 36(1)(d) inserted by No. 121/1994 s. 188(c), amended by No. 99/2005 s. 15(b), repealed by No. 85/2006 s. 22.

    *     *     *     *     *

S. 36(1)(e) inserted by No. 121/1994 s. 188(c), amended by Nos 62/1995 s. 10(b), 86/1995 s. 5, 99/2005 s. 15(c), repealed by No. 23/2019 s. 105.

    *     *     *     *     *

S. 36(1)(f) inserted by No. 62/1995 s. 10(b), amended by No. 99/2005 s. 15(d).

        (f)     any other water, other than recycled water, to which an Authority has access.

    (2)     An application must—

        (a)     be made in a form and manner approved by the Minister; and

S. 36(2)(b) amended by No. 5/2002 s. 12,
repealed by No. 32/2010 s. 21.

    *     *     *     *     *

        (c)     be accompanied by the prescribed application fee.

    (3)     The Minister must forward a copy of an application to—

        (a)     the Minister administering the Conservation, Forests and Lands Act 1987 ; and

        (b)     the Minister administering the Planning and Environment Act 1987 ; and

        (c)     any public statutory body which the Minister considers may be directly affected by the application.

    (4)     For the purposes of this section, "waterway" includes any collection of water which is from time to time replenished in whole or in part by water coming by a natural sub-surface path from a waterway.
